On celcius scale the temperature of body increases by 40^ C . The increase in temperature on Fahrenheit scale is :

Options

  1. A68^ F
  2. B75^ F
  3. C72^ F
  4. D70^ F

Correct answer

C. 72^ F

Step-by-step solution

We know that per ^ C change is equivalent to 1.8^ change in ^ F . 40^ change on celcius scale will corresponds to 72^ change on Fahrenheit scale. Hence option (3)
